.cm-sight-testimonial>h2{font-size:48px;color:#0778f5;line-height:55px;text-align:left;font-family:Nunito;font-weight:700;font-style:normal;margin-bottom:13px}.cm-sight-testimonial .cm-item-inner .column-bg-overlay-wrap{box-shadow:7px 10px 50px rgb(0 0 0 / 8%);border-radius:20px;overflow:hidden;pointer-events:none;position:absolute;z-index:0;height:270px;width:100%;top:0;left:0;content:' ';display:block;transition:background-color .45s cubic-bezier(.25,1,.33,1),opacity .45s cubic-bezier(.25,1,.33,1);-webkit-transition:background-color .45s cubic-bezier(.25,1,.33,1),opacity .45s cubic-bezier(.25,1,.33,1);position:relative}.cm-sight-testimonial .cm-right{position:relative;width:100%}.cm-sight-testimonial .slick-dots li button{display:inline-block;zoom:1;background:0;border:0;padding:0}.cm-sight-testimonial .slick-dots li button:before{width:10px;height:10px;margin:5px 7px;background:rgba(0,0,0,.25);display:block;-webkit-backface-visibility:visible;border-radius:30px;-webkit-transition:all .13s ease;transition:all .13s ease;-webkit-transform:scale(.9);transform:scale(.9)}.cm-sight-testimonial .slick-dots li.slick-active button:before{-webkit-transform:scale(1.5);transform:scale(1.5);background-color:#0078b7 !important}.cm-sight-testimonial .slick-dots li button:hover:before{background-color:#0078b7 !important}.cm-sight-testimonial .cm-item-inner{margin-left:-1%;margin-right:-1%;display:flex;display:-ms-flexbox;-ms-flex-wrap:wrap;flex-wrap:wrap}.cm-sight-testimonial .cm-item-inner .cm-left{padding-left:1%;padding-right:1%;width:50%;text-align:center}.cm-sight-testimonial .cm-item-inner .cm-left img{max-width:250px !important;margin-left:auto;margin-right:auto;display:block}.cm-sight-testimonial>h2{padding-bottom:25px}.cm-sight-testimonial .cm-item-inner .cm-right{padding-left:1%;padding-right:1%;width:50%}.cm-sight-testimonial .cm-item-inner .cm-right .cm-content{padding:calc(1245px * 0.03);position:absolute;top:50%;transform:translateY(-50%)}.cm-sight-testimonial .cm-item-inner .cm-right .cm-content p{padding:0}.cm-sight-testimonial .item-2 .cm-item-inner .cm-left img{max-width:300px !important}.cm-sight-testimonial .item-3 .cm-item-inner .cm-left img{margin-top:50px}.cm-sight-testimonial .item-4 .cm-item-inner .cm-left img{max-width:200px !important;margin-top:70px}.cm-sight-testimonial .item-5 .cm-item-inner .cm-left img{max-width:200px !important;margin-top:50px}.cm-sight-testimonial .slick-list{overflow:visible}.cm-sight-testimonial{overflow:hidden}.cm-sight-testimonial .cm-item{opacity:0}.cm-sight-testimonial .cm-item.slick-active{opacity:1}.cm-sight-testimonial .cm-item-inner .cm-right{margin-right:5%;padding-right:0;width:45%}.cm-sight-testimonial .slick-dots li{margin:0}.cm-sight-testimonial .slick-dots li button,.cm-sight-testimonial .slick-dots li{width:auto;min-width:24px}.cm-sight-testimonial .slick-dots li button:before{opacity:1}@media(max-width:1424px){.cm-sight-testimonial .cm-item-inner .cm-right .cm-content{padding:calc((100vw - 180px) * 0.03)}}@media(max-width:999px){.cm-sight-testimonial>h2{font-size:28px !important;line-height:46.4px !important}.cm-sight-testimonial .cm-item-inner .cm-left{width:100%}.cm-sight-testimonial .cm-item-inner .cm-right{width:95%}}@media(max-width:690px){.cm-sight-testimonial .cm-item-inner .cm-left img{max-width:150px !important}.cm-sight-testimonial>h2{font-size:24.5px !important;line-height:40.6px !important}.cm-sight-testimonial .cm-item-inner .column-bg-overlay-wrap{height:400px}}